**Q: The Fernloft image cache keeps growing until the host OOMs — known issue?**

Yes. Decoded bitmaps are retained by a stale eviction index after bulk invalidations. The short-term mitigation is restarting the cache daemon, which is safe and drops no persisted data. A permanent fix ships in the next patch train. The full diagnosis and restart procedure are on the internal runbook page below.

runbook for kahog-tafop: https://confluence.zemvarsys.internal/projects/pages/browse/browse/91a2

Deduplication service — security review onboarding

The Mergewell pipeline deduplicates customer records by hashing normalized name and postal fields, then comparing against the candidate index. No raw personal data leaves the worker; only salted hashes are transmitted to the matching service. Reviewers should note that the salt and the matching-service credential are distinct: the salt is rotated quarterly, while the credential lives in the worker's env file as the following line.

vault entry, yahif-yajep: COURIER_KEY29=b802bdf8034096b65a51c6ba5abe2

Ticket: RenderLoom markdown pipeline connection failures

For the weekly sync: the RenderLoom pipeline has been intermittently failing to reach its metadata database since Tuesday, causing roughly 4% of markdown render jobs to retry. Timeouts cluster around the top of each hour, suggesting a scheduled job is exhausting the pool. No code changes shipped this week. The affected service connects with the following string:

replica DSN, kajep-yahag: mssql://praok_svc:iF@db-8d68.plorvaio.local:5432/eliion